                @dc42
                I think the WIFI module is dead
                right now I make order new controller
                but entail it's arrive can I replace with this
                https://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B07BRQTLZG/ref=ox_sc_act_title_1?smid=A144J8BE3R51KJ&psc=1
                is will work if I change the old one with this ?

                1 Reply Last reply Reply Quote 0
                • dc42undefined
                  dc42 administrators
                  last edited by dc42

                  I agree, the WiFi module is dead, because it failed to connect at all the baud rates that were tried. With the right tools (hot air desoldering equipment or very low melting point solder), it can be removed and then replaced. Don't try to remove it without one of those.

                  The ESP-12S that you linked to is the correct module. Or you can use the ESP-07S + external antenna, such as https://www.amazon.com/Chironal-ESP8266-ESP-07S-Wireless-Transceiver/dp/B07M7L1CGL/ref=sr_1_12?s=electronics&ie=UTF8&qid=1548322176&sr=1-12&keywords=esp-07s.
